
A scrapper. That’s how Debbie Grayson, founder of TLC Contract Group, describes the home at 3404 Purdue Avenue in University Park at first glance. But upon a closer look and realizing its potential, she knew the 1930-built home was a real keeper.
“The house just needed some help,” she says.
She took the house down to the studs and totally revamped it with new interior and exterior paint, new landscaping, a completely updated kitchen, and an additional 400+ square feet. The result is a charming one-and-half story cottage with a large front porch and an open floor plan that’s perfect for a young family or empty nesters.

It features a gourmet kitchen with custom cabinets, quartz counters, and new appliances. It has two living areas, a primary bedroom downstairs with a spacious master bath including a large shower, freestanding tub, double vanities, and a sizable owner’s closet.
